Setting the correct boiling point for water

Heating the appliance

Before you cook food for the first time, adjust the device to
the boiling temperature of water, which varies depending on
the altitude of the installation location. In this process, the
water-carrying components are rinsed.
You must carry out this operation as it is essential to
ensure proper functioning.
^ Run the Steam (212°F / 100°C) mode for 15 minutes.
Proceed as described in "Quick Guide".
If you move the appliance to a new location, it will need to be
re-set for the new altitude if this differs from the old one by
more than 984 ft. (300 m). To do this, run the descale
program (see "Cleaning and care - Descale").
To remove grease from the convection heating element, heat
the Combi Steam Oven up with nothing in it at 400°F (200°C)
using the Convection Bake mode for 30 minutes. Proceed as
described in "Operation".
There will be a slight smell the first time the heating element is
heated.
The smell and any vapors will dissipate after a short time, and
do not indicate a faulty connection or appliance. It is
important to ensure that the room is well ventilated during this
process.
